[HTML][HTML] The Rad9-Hus1-Rad1 checkpoint clamp regulates interaction of TopBP1 with ATR

J Lee, A Kumagai, WG Dunphy - Journal of Biological Chemistry, 2007 - ASBMB
TopBP1 serves as an activator of the ATR-ATRIP complex in response to the presence of
incompletely replicated or damaged DNA. This process involves binding of ATR to the ATR-
activating domain of TopBP1, which is located between BRCT domains VI and VII. TopBP1
displays increased binding to ATR-ATRIP in Xenopus egg extracts containing checkpoint-
inducing DNA templates. We show that an N-terminal region of TopBP1 containing BRCT
